Your Focus
- Seeking a Senior Atmospheric Sensor Engineer who will be focusing heavily on micro atmospheric wind sensors, algorithm development, fluid dynamics, and environmental tuning and testing, ensuring high-accuracy data collection and best-in-class real-world performance.
Your Role
- Develop and optimize signal processing and data fusion algorithms for atmospheric sensor systems.
- Implement machine learning techniques for sensor calibration, anomaly detection, and data validation.
- Enhance real-time data acquisition and processing pipelines for high-precision environmental measurements.
- Apply computational fluid dynamics (CFD) to model airflows, turbulence, and sensor-environment interactions.
- Design and validate sensor housings and components to optimize air sampling and minimize measurement biases.
- Work closely with mechanical and electrical engineers to integrate fluid dynamics insights into sensor design.
- Develop and execute rigorous environmental testing protocols in controlled and field conditions.
- Analyze sensor performance under extreme temperatures, humidity, pressure, and pollution levels.
- Utilize wind tunnels, climate chambers, and real-world deployments to validate sensor accuracy and reliability.
